This role involves receiving and staging merchandise by department, marking it appropriately for placement within the facility, and delivering it to the correct department. The clerk will stack received merchandise on pallets or carts, complete requisition forms for inventory and supplies, and notify the manager/supervisor of low stock levels in a timely manner. Responsibilities also include receiving deliveries, storing perishables properly, and rotating stock. The position requires inspecting deliveries and date times to verify freshness, cleanliness, consistency, and quality throughout case lots, and refusing acceptance of damaged, unacceptable, or incorrect items. Adherence to food safety and handling policies and procedures across all food-related areas is essential. Additionally, the clerk will organize, clean, and sanitize all refrigerators and freezers, floors, food equipment, and drains, and remove empty pallets, cardboard, and trash, placing them in proper storage areas.
